“So let God work His will in you. Yell a loud no to the Devil and watch him scamper” (James 4:7 MSG).
Nothing about your life takes God by surprise. Before you were born, He carefully prearranged a life of victory and goodness for you to walk in. Ephesians 2:10 (AMP) says, “For we are God’s [own] handiwork (His workmanship), recreated in Christ Jesus… that we may do those good works which God predestined (planned beforehand)… living the good life which He prearranged and made ready for us to live.”This means that the good life is already yours—so never settle for anything less.
Fear, unforgiveness, insecurity, and malice are all inconsistent with the life of light you’ve been called to live. Someone once asked how long they should put up with insults before proving they weren’t weak. Jesus answered that question when He told Peter, “seventy times seven.” In other words, don’t let the darkness around you change the character of God’s light within you.
God’s plan for you is not only good, it is eternal. James 1:17 reminds us that “every good and perfect gift is from above… and [He] does not change like shifting shadows.”His plan isn’t altered by times, seasons, or even your mistakes. He chose to bless you long before you knew Him—not because of your works, but because of His unchanging love.
But for His plan to manifest in your daily life, you must give His Word first place. Colossians 3:16 says, “Let the Word of Christ dwell in you richly in all wisdom…”That requires intentional focus and obedience to the Word. Jesus declared, “Man shall not live on bread alone, but on every word that comes from the mouth of God.” To live the good life God prearranged, you must live in His Word. As you do, the Spirit of God will work His will in you, making you a wonder to your world.
